[QUOTE="elf, post: 828313, member: 43050"] Oh you mean it turns lake a ktm!! Marcus is right, it may turn better with more sag. My ktm turns much better in ruts with more sag. The only place less sag helps is on flat corners with no ruts or berms.If you think about it when your in a rut or berm your not really steering with the front wheel, but both wheels are helping to change direction.
